The universal elastic anisotropy index of ZnSe in B1 phase increases in scaled-down slope, indicating the impression of stress on B1 period is smaller than that on B3 period. The least price of AU in B3 framework is still larger than the most worth of AU in B1 framework from the pressure variety of 0–30 GPa, revealing that ZnSe in B3 stage is more anisotropy.

The structural and elastic Houses of ZnSe with B3 and B1 phases under different strain have been investigated by the initial principle method based on density practical theory. The acquired structural parameters of ZnSe in each B3 and B1 constructions are in very good arrangement With all the offered values. The transition tension of ZnSe from B3 to B1 was predicted as fourteen.85 GPa by utilizing the enthalpy–strain details, which is very well in step with experimental end result.
